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of scythian

- Of or pertaining to Scythia (a name given to the northern part of Asia, and Europe adjoining to Asia), or its language or inhabitants.
- A native or inhabitant of Scythia; specifically (Ethnol.), one of a Slavonic race which in early times occupied Eastern Europe.
- The language of the Scythians.